#033730 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#033730 is composed of 1.2% red, 21.6%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 12.7% yellow and 78.4% black. It has a hue angle of 171.9 degrees, a saturation of 89.7% and a lightness of 11.4%. #033730 color hex could be obtained by blending #066e60 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

#033730 color description : Very dark cyan.

#033730 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#033730 has RGB values of R:3, G:55,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0, Y:0.13, K:0.78. Its decimal value is 210736.

Shades and Tints of #033730

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#011210 is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#033730

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1c1e1e is the less saturated color, while #013932 is the most saturated one.
